



SCOOT: Open Source Power Assist
Improving Mobility for Wheelchair Users
One of the most popular and common accessories for manual wheelchairs is power assist, which essentially turns a manual wheelchair into a powered one. SCOOT is a user-first design built for affordability, safety, and easy maintenance. This system utilizes widely available electric scooter parts and tool batteries, allowing for quick and low-cost repairs. Its modular system allows users or any scooter shop to replace key components. Additionally, the “safe-stop” feature prevents potentially hazardous malfunctions. SCOOT is accessible, repairable, and designed for real-world use.
This design solution enhances the accessibility of electromobility for people with disabilities. It means that a wheelchair power assist system is accessible to everyone. Democratic design in action.
